logo

Output 59db7c44a5ac1e14797f46ff2483620aa2c50f830355b482c216c3f5a17a2efd:0

value
9509126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93b8441ffbaefa94f201bced3f743391b14d5d51 OP_EQUAL
address
3FA5zn1SjsH4M7GDUuCQSE59gysbSdY2Ja
transaction
59db7c44a5ac1e14797f46ff2483620aa2c50f830355b482c216c3f5a17a2efd